Australia's former deputy chief medical officer Dr Nick Coatsworth believes the spread of Omicron and vaccination coverage will allow the global population to generate immunity to COVID-19.

Australia's former deputy chief medical officer says the coronavirus pandemic"will end" in 2022.

Dr Coatsworth commended the Australian population for rolling up their sleeves for COVID-19 vaccines in high numbers and for accepting government-imposed restrictions to slow the spread of the virus.
